We are seeking a Medical Assistant to provide exceptional support to our providers and ensure a seamless patient experience. Our ideal candidate is compassionate, detail-oriented, and thrives in a fast-paced medical environment. This role involves assisting with medical procedures, managing patient communications, and providing high-quality patient care.

Job Responsibilities
– Assist providers with medical and surgical dermatology procedures.
– Prepare exam rooms and surgical suites, ensuring all necessary equipment and supplies are available.
– Educate patients on pre- and post-procedure care and answer questions related to treatments.
– Obtain patient medical histories and document information accurately in electronic medical records.
– Handle patient scheduling, prescription refills, and communication with pharmacies.
– Ensure patient confidentiality and compliance with HIPAA regulations.
– Assist with wound care, suture removals, and dressing changes as directed by providers.
– Collaborate with front desk and clinical staff to ensure smooth patient flow.
-Maintain cleanliness and sterilization of instruments and clinical areas.

Job Requirements
– Strong attention to detail and ability to multitask in a clinical environment.
–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to provide compassionate patient care.
– Proficiency in electronic medical records (EMR) systems.
– Ability to work collaboratively with a team and maintain professionalism under pressure.

Education and/or Experience
High school diploma or equivalent is required.
A minimum of one (1) year of experience in a medical office or surgical assisting role is preferred.
Dermatology or surgical experience is a plus.
